To the Fallout

To the fallout

 I see in the distance skies 
How lightning crashes 
Illuminates this pitch black night 
I choose to burn all I ever loved 
Then burn the ashes 
Erase every word of endearment
Blinded by salted water
I give release to all memories
That return to my eyes in flashes 
Doubtful if I can find 		
An anecdote to what you’ve left behind 
 Drops of that sweet nectar I aroused from you 
That flowed from your veins to mine
 Like turbulent seas
Now I ail with this poison 
 A brew concocted just for me 
Destitute, faithless, fallen
 Completely incomplete
Yet felled by this weakness that makes me pray for your pity
 How your arrogance grows 
As every hour goes 
 You wring my own tears
 On these seeds of loneliness you have sown 
 I plot my revenge 
Or some vestige of retribution 
My plans flutter to my feet 
Like feathers of fallen angels
 I see now the looming clouds of storm 
Gales that howl and sway 
Bring messengers of the coming regime 
That shall rule my remaining days 
In these searing embers 
I swear to hide 
All the torment that I suffer inside 
 But stuck in between the devil and the deep blue sea
How I would spend this world’s weight in gold 
Only to know for the hundredth last time		
If you still think of me.
